The market for electric scooters under ₹1.5 Lakh in India features strong competition between tech-forward disruptors and legacy automakers. --- ## 1\. Top Pick for Families: Ather Rizta (S or Z Variants) Ather shifted its focus from purely sporty scooters to create a highly practical, family-oriented EV. Under ₹1.5 Lakh, you can get the mid-spec variants which offer massive utility. \* \*\*Ex-Showroom Price:\*\* \~₹1.21 Lakh to ₹1.46 Lakh (Depending on variant/pack) \* \*\*True Range:\*\* \~105 km to 125 km (IDC range up to 159 km) \* \*\*Key Highlights:\*\* It features the \*\*largest seat in the segment\*\*, a massive 34-litre under-seat storage, and state-of-the-art safety features like "FallSafe" and skid control. It delivers excellent build quality and reliable service. ## 2\. Best for Practicality & Storage: River Indie Dubbed the "SUV of scooters," the River Indie is designed for those who need maximum utility, ruggedness, and unique looks. \* \*\*Ex-Showroom Price:\*\* \~₹1.46 Lakh \* \*\*True Range:\*\* \~120 km (IDC range 161 km) \* \*\*Key Highlights:\*\* It boasts \*\*43 litres of under-seat storage\*\* plus an additional 12-litre glovebox. It features unique front pannier mounts, crash guards built directly into the body, and 14-inch wheels that tackle potholes far better than standard scooters. ## 3\. Best for Reliability & Build: TVS iQube (Base & S 3.4 kWh) If you want an electric scooter that feels exactly like a traditional petrol scooter but runs on electricity, the TVS iQube is the most balanced option. \* \*\*Ex-Showroom Price:\*\* \~₹1.15 Lakh to ₹1.35 Lakh \* \*\*True Range:\*\* \~100 km \* \*\*Key Highlights:\*\* Extremely comfortable suspension, \*\*rock-solid build quality\*\*, and a highly predictable riding experience. Its conservative styling appeals heavily to mature riders, and TVS's widespread service network adds substantial peace of mind. ## 4\. Best Retro Style: Bajaj Chetak (Premium / C35) Bajaj revived its iconic moniker with a premium, all-metal body design that stands out for its elegant aesthetics and seamless build. \* \*\*Ex-Showroom Price:\*\* \~₹1.15 Lakh to ₹1.39 Lakh \* \*\*True Range:\*\* \~113 km to 127 km \* \*\*Key Highlights:\*\* \*\*Full-metal body\*\* construction (very rare in modern scooters), classic retro styling, and a sharp, clear color display. It feels premium to touch and offers predictable, safe handling. ## 5\. Best Value & Performance: Ola S1 X (4kWh) / S1 Air For sheer range and tech features per rupee, Ola remains tough to beat, provided you have an active service center nearby. \* \*\*Ex-Showroom Price:\*\* \~₹1.00 Lakh to ₹1.20 Lakh \* \*\*True Range:\*\* \~140 km to 190 km (depending on the 3kWh or 4kWh battery variant) \* \*\*Key Highlights:\*\* Exceptional acceleration, high top speeds (up to 90 km/h), and an incredibly long range for its price bracket. The S1 X brings physical keys back to the lineup, answering a major user complaint regarding older tech-only models. --- ### Summary Checklist for Your Decision: \* Choose the \*\*Ather Rizta\*\* if you want the best overall comfort, safety tech, and reliability for a family. \* Choose the \*\*River Indie\*\* if you love unique styling, carry heavy luggage, or encounter bad roads daily. \* Choose the \*\*TVS iQube\*\* or \*\*Bajaj Chetak\*\* if you want trusted, conventional brand backing and high-end build quality. \* Choose the \*\*Ola S1 X (4kWh)\*\* if maximum range and raw acceleration on a tight budget are your highest priorities.

Based on 2026 market trends and current models, here are the top electric scooters available in India under ₹1.5 lakh (on-road/approx) that offer the best combination of speed, range, and features:! \*\*TVS iQube Series:\*\* Consistently ranked for reliability, comfort, and build quality. The ST or S variants offer excellent real-world range, robust build, and an extensive service network.! \*\*Ola S1 Pro / S1 Air:\*\* The \*\*S1 Pro Gen 2\*\* offers the best performance (over 100 km/h top speed) and highest feature set (riding modes, display functionality) in this segment, while the \*\*S1 Air\*\* provides better value and a flatter floorboard for city commuting.! \*\*Ather 450X / 450S:\*\* Known for superior build quality, sporty handling, and a fast, reliable interface. It is the premier choice for enthusiasts seeking performance, with excellent after-sales support via Ather Grid.! \*\*Bajaj Chetak (Premium):\*\* Offers a premium, all-metal body and classic design. The 2026 models feature enhanced battery capacity and a refined riding experience for comfort-focused users.! \*\*Komaki SE Series:\*\* A strong contender if you need a high-range, lower-speed option, with models such as the offering significant range per charge around ₹70k-80k, suitable for daily commuting rather than high-speed riding. \*\*Key 2026 Buying Considerations:\*\* - \*\*Range:\*\* Focus on "Real-World" (Eco/Normal mode) range rather than "IDC" (ideal) range. - \*\*Battery:\*\* Look for larger packs (>3 kWh) for better daily usability. - \*\*Performance:\*\* Check for at least 80 km/h+ speed for city riding safety.
